InsidiousInsidious, another horror film from the creators of the Saw franchise, director James Wan and writer Leigh Whannell, arrived on DVD and Blu-ray on July 12, 2011. Sony Pictures Home Entertainment has priced the movie at $30.99 and $35.99, respectively.

The thriller stars Patrick Wilson (The Switch) and Rose Byrne (TV’s Damages) who’ve just moved into a new house and start hearing strange noises. Okay, doesn’t sound too original so far, but then one of their children falls into a mysterious coma and a woman (Lin Shaye, American Cowslip) tells them its not their house that’s haunted — it’s their son. Barbara Hershey (Black Swan) also stars as Wilson’s mother.

Despite the PG-13 rating, Insidious is reportedly mighty scary (watch a review from Movie Irv), getting its thrills not from blood and gore, but from suspense, lighting and sound — the kind of “things go bump in the night” movies that stay with us when we’re trying to sleep. The film scored well with critics and grossed $52 million in theaters.

Three featurettes are on both the DVD and Blu-ray:

  • “Horror 101: The Exclusive Seminar”
  • “On Set With Insidious
  • Insidious Entities”

The movie was made available for downoad the same day.
